Kent Kings = 41
1. Scott Nicholls - 3, 2', 3, 2, 3 = 13+1
2. Tom Bacon - R/R (PH-0, PS-3, BM-2, DG-1) = 6
3. Paul Starke - X, 3, 3, 3, 3, 1 = 13
4. Paul Hurry - 0, 1, X, 1, 0 = 2
5. Cameron Heeps - 0, 2, 1, 0 = 3
6. Ben Morley - 2, 1', 2, 0, 2 = 7+1
7. Daniel Gilkes - 1', 1, 0, 1, 0 = 3+1
Redcar Bears = 49
1. Charles Wright - 1', 1', 2', 1 = 5+3
2. James Sarjeant - 2, X, 2, 3, 3 = 10
3. Jake Allen - 3, 3, Fx, 2, 3, 2 = 13
4. Jordan Stewart - R/R (JS DK-2', JP-0, DK-2, JA-3) = 7+1
5. Michael Palm Toft - 3, 0, 2, 3, 0 = 8
6. Drew Kemp (G) - 3, 2', 1, 1, 2, 1', 1 = 11+2
7. Jordan Palin (G) - 0, 2', 0, 0 = 2+1
Heat Results
Redcar win the toss and will choose gates in heat 15. Kent choose 2 & 4.
Heat 01: Nicholls, Sarjeant, Wright, Hurry 3-3 (3-3) 57.7
Line Up: Nicholls,Bacon Hurry, Wright, Sarjeant
Comments: Hurry takes R/R for Kent.
Stopped. Sarjeant jumps the start, all 4 back.
Re-run From the gate.

Heat 02: Kemp, Morley, Gilkes, Palin 3-3 (6-6) 57.3
Line Up: Morley, Gilkes, Kemp, Palin
Comments: Stopped. It's the turn of Jordan Palin to jump the start this time! All 4 back.
Re-run From the gate. Kemp shows he hasn't forgotten his way around CP with a convincing tapes to flag win.

Heat 03: Allen, Kemp, Hurry, Starke (X) 1-5 (7-11) 57.8
Line Up: Starke, Hurry, Allen,Stewart Sarjeant Kemp
Comments: Sarjeant takes R/R for Redcar.
Stopped. Stopped. No prizes for guessing who jumped the start! James Sarjeant is excluded from rerun as his 2nd offence. Kemp replaces.
Re-run Stopped. Allen was leading until Starke passed him bend 2 lap 2. Allen them fell going into bend 3. He's up but excluded from rerun.
Confusion here as the ref has now decided to exclude Paul Starke saying he took Allen's front wheel.
Verdict is that Starke caught Allen's front wheel when he passes him on B2 and this caused Allen's front wheel to collapse along backstraight. This is why ref has excluded Starke.
